About the Show

Smash Lab is an American reality television series produced by Darlow Smithson Productions for the Discovery Channel in which the premise is to take everyday technology and test it in extraordinary ways.

The series premiered in the USA on Discovery Channel on 26 December, 2007. There are two seasons to date.

Smash Lab premiered in South Africa on DStv's Discovery Channel on Wednesday 10 September 2008, at 21h00. There are 13 hour-long episodes in the first season.

Synopsis

The next generation in destruction instruction, Smash Lab features a team of maverick engineers as they take on everyday technology and apply it in revolutionary new ways.

First they break down the technology to see how it works and then use their know-how to see how it could be used in a different, supersized way.

Could bulletproof Kevlar protect an airliner from bombs? Could a car airbag be reinvented to stop a helicopter from sinking after ditching at sea? The Smash Lab team aims to find out.

Filmed at their Crash Lab in California, the team puts their ambitious plans to the test and captures them from every camera angle imaginable.

Smash Lab is a visual feast of fireballs, explosions, crashes, collapses, collisions and impacts, because sometimes destruction is good for you.

The Smash Lab team is composed of Deanne Bell (scientist), Chuck Messer (engineer), Nick Blair (designer, Season 1 only), Kevin Cook (creative expert, Season 1 only), Reverend Gadget (fabricator, Season 2) and Nathaniel Taylor (artisan, Season 2).

Blair has a degree in industrial design and both Bell and Cook have degrees in mechanical engineering. Messer has an undergraduate degree in industrial engineering as well as a graduate degree in industrial design.
